Дана строка, состоящая из нескольких слов. Необходимо переставить слова так, чтобы сначала шли самые частые.
Если какие-то слова встречаются одинаковое число раз, раньше должно идти то, которое идет раньше алфавиту (то есть в лексикографическом порядке).
const s1 = "it is true for all that that that that that that that refers to is not the same that that that that refers to" console.log(sortByFreq(s1)); // "that that that that that that that that that that that is is refers refers to to all for it not same the true" const s2 = "2 46 38 1 \ 116 14 20 \ 15 14 21 \ 14 0 17"; console.log(sortByFreq(s2)); // "14 14 14 0 1 116 15 17 2 20 21 38 46"